Renesas Electronics is hiring a Senior Manager Field Applications Engineer (FAE)

Responsibilities

  • Serve as the main technical contact for major datacenter customers, guiding power system designs from initial concept to mass production.
  • Offer deep technical expertise on digital multiphase controllers, power modules, and advanced power delivery systems for servers.
  • Conduct reviews of schematics, provide layout recommendations, and support validation planning, startup, power sequencing, transient response testing, and debugging.
  • Produce and deliver technical documentation for customers, including validation outcomes, progress updates, and final program reports.
  • Diagnose and resolve complex power-related issues quickly using oscilloscopes, current probes, electronic loads, and transient testing equipment.
  • Oversee and advance technical issue escalations with internal engineering groups to ensure timely and effective resolutions.
  • Lead, coach, and grow a team of field applications engineers specializing in digital power and datacenter technologies.
  • Define clear roles, performance expectations, and technical growth goals for each team member.
  • Develop onboarding and training programs for new hires and junior engineers to prepare them for lab activities and client interactions.
  • Manage resource distribution by aligning team capacity and skills with customer demands.
  • Perform performance evaluations, support career progression, and foster a culture of responsibility, teamwork, and technical excellence.
  • Oversee technical execution for high-priority datacenter programs, including AI processors, server CPUs, and networking infrastructure.
  • Work closely with sales teams to align technical resources, customer priorities, and project timelines.
  • Maintain visibility into program progress using dashboards that track milestones, risks, capital needs, and next actions.
  • Ensure consistent implementation across teams during design, layout, testing, reporting, and customer sign-off phases.
  • Deliver concise and meaningful program updates to senior management.
  • Collaborate with product, marketing, and sales teams to relay customer feedback and help shape future product development.
  • Advocate for field-driven insights to influence next-generation digital multiphase and modular power solutions.
  • Coordinate technical transitions and joint engagements between global field applications teams.
  • Support the development of technical materials, training modules, and best practices for use across the field applications organization.
